Across the UK they have acquired a fleet of Waste to Energy & Biomass plants, including the South Clyde Energy Centre currently under construction in Glasgow. Gren operate across Northern Europe, focusing on power generation, district heating (and cooling) and industrial energy services. Gren aim to reduce carbon emissions, enhance energy efficiency and support the shift towards cleaner, more reliable energy systems.
